首页 > 其他分享 >3.5mm耳机孔简介

3.5mm耳机孔简介

时间:2024-07-18 08:58:03浏览次数:9  
标签:耳机 声道 mm 电路 3.5 电压

一、简单介绍

主流的大小,2.5mm、3.5mm、6.35mm。

其中,3.5和6.35之间用转接线就能转换。6.35前身的应用场景就是电话交换机。

2.5mm插头因为比3.5mm插头还要细一些,结构十分脆弱,非常容易扭断,目前基本被淘汰。

 

二、兼容问题

主要是因为3.5mm TRRS接口规范定义不一样造成的。

目前国际上通行的两种3.5mm接口设计标准:

一种是OMTP,另一种是CTIA。OMTP是中国采用的标准,CTIA是国际标准。

 

O系的设计:只有按下麦克风键的时候,麦克风的功能才会激活。按电路图的设计,麦克风线路在未按下的时候,电阻比较大,这部分电路就不会和左右声道的电路并联起来。此时左右声道的电路为串联电路,由于两只耳机的阻抗相同,串联电路根据电势差,为两只耳机均匀的分配电压。如果音源给两个耳机不同的电压信号,会根据最小的电压信号平均分配给两个耳机。OTMP标准的耳机头插入CTIA标准的耳机孔,左、右两声道发出的声音,实际上是当前输出电压大的声道信号与当前输出电压低的声道信号之差的二分之一。由于人声一般是单声道,在左右声道信号里就被抵消了。(电压分配这块还是没搞懂,按串联电路不是两个电压加起来再平分吗?)

它提供模拟信号输出,论供电,它只能提供2.5V以内的交流电平信号,电流只有毫安级别,可以说传输功率很低。这下知道主动降噪耳机为什么要自带电池了吧?

耳机孔提供给耳机的供电功率,用音频发烧友的说法,就是所谓的「推力」。

   

标签:耳机,声道,mm,电路,3.5,电压
From: https://www.cnblogs.com/ryutuo/p/18308681

相关文章

  • The 2022 ICPC Polish Collegiate Programming Contest (AMPPZ 2022)
    Preface今天由于是我们队搬毒瘤场,因此下午就不用集中训练索性继续VPUCup这场题很有外国场的风格,代码量和科技含量都不大,只要动动脑筋就行了,最后也是刚好打到了10题下班A.Aliases不难发现假设\(a=b=0\),则\(c\le\log_{10}n\le7\),因此只要考虑\(a+b+c\le7\)的情况,......
  • SMU Summer 2024 Contest Round 4
    1.HandV原题链接:http://162.14.124.219/contest/1008/problem/B二进制枚举行列即可查看代码#include<bits/stdc++.h>#defineintlonglong#definePIIpair<int,int>usingnamespacestd;intn,m,k;chara[10][10];signedmain(){ios::sync_with_stdio(fals......
  • cerebro 报错: Oops, cannot start the server. com.google.common.util.concurrent.Un
    @目录前言环境异常修改方案第二次报错修改方式成功前言使用elasticsearch+springboot实现新闻搜索功能:https://javapub.net.cn/star/project/news-search-es/遇到的错误记录。环境cerebro下载地址:https://github.com/lmenezes/cerebro使用了最新的版本:cerebro-0......
  • ICS_S7comm协议分析-2021工业互联网内部预选赛
    根据功能可以看出是设置密码拆分data数据,用前两个与0x55进行异或接着对剩下的数操作,操作为与自己距离为-2的数进行异或list=[0x26,0x62,0x10,0x42,0x37,0x7e,0x16,0x52]passwd=[]foriinrange(0,len(list)):ifi==0ori==1:passwd.append(chr(list[i]^0x55))......
  • pytorch|找不到 fbgemm.dll 问题处理
    问题现象运行逻辑:importtorch报错如下:Traceback(mostrecentcalllast):File"C:\scaffold\metasequoia-tyc\ner_address\test_torch.py",line1,in<module>importtorchFile"D:\py\Python310\lib\site-packages\torch\__init__.......
  • 多种模块格式,包括 ES, CommonJS, UMD, AMD, SystemJS 和 IIFE的区别点分别是什么
    【转】https://zhuanlan.zhihu.com/p/668530823以下是各种模块格式的主要特点:ESModules(ESM):这是ECMAScript6(ES6)引入的官方标准格式。它支持导入和导出语句,以及静态分析和tree-shaking。它是唯一的静态模块系统,意味着你可以在编译时确定导入和导出的内容。CommonJS(C......
  • 汇川Easy521和宜科CAMM58编码器之间的CanOpen通讯
    1,AutoShop组态CANopen通讯模块 2,添加CAN配置 3,导入编码器EDS文件 4,将导入后的EDS文件拖入CANopen组态中 5,配置主站协议类型,站号,波特率,默认协议类型:CANLink,站号:63,波特率:250Kbps  6,配置主站映射寄存器地址 7,从站参数配置 ......
  • R包:DiagrammeR流程图
    介绍DiagrammeR依赖于图形描述语言Graphviz,可以通过R包igraph和visNetwork访问。DiagrammeR通过将有效的图规范以DOT语言的形式传递给grViz()函数来输出图。加载R包采用DiagrammeRR包,它提供了以下函数:使用create_graph()和render_graph()在节点和边的列表......
  • idea git 提交代码(commit)代码后,没有未push后怎么撤回
    1.方法一 第二步: HEAD~1--->Reset---> 右键项目--》 或者 接下来----》 提醒-----------------  提醒---------   提醒-------------(重要的话说三遍),如果本地写很多代码逻辑,一定做好备份直接选择远程分支,checkoutandrebase(做好本地新写未提交......
  • Command Pattern
    命令模式它允许你将请求(命令)封装为一个对象,从而使你可以参数化不同的请求、队列或记录请求日志,以及支持可撤销的操作。什么是可撤销?在命令模式中,每个命令都是一个独立的对象,它们封装了请求的参数和执行逻辑。通过将每个命令封装为一个对象,我们可以轻松地实现可撤销的操作。实现......